Use this scenario when you want your Conan client to connect to repository (e.g., an internal Artifactory) and ignore public repositories like Conan Center. conan repository exclusive

JFrog Artifactory offers a free tier for up to three users, but the paid versions provide robust Conan support. Artifactory creates a "virtual repository" that aggregates your exclusive local repo with public remotes.

The "conan repository exclusive" is not a single, monolithic feature, but a powerful combination of capabilities: private hosting, granular access control, vendoring of dependencies, sources backup, and the strict separation of read and write permissions. Implementing one or more of these strategies transforms the Conan package manager from a simple dependency fetcher into a robust, enterprise-grade infrastructure for managing your C/C++ software supply chain.

By controlling the exclusive space, you turn Conan into a SBOM (Software Bill of Materials) generator. You know exactly who uploaded which binary and when.
